Doulas...

  • Are trained professionals.
  • Provide emotional, physical, and informational support to a person during their pregnancy, the birth of their child or children, and just after the birth.
  • Do not perform clinical tasks, like fetal heart tone assessment or cervical examinations.
  • Provide support that can result in lower rates of medical interventions during labor including assisted deliveries and cesarean births.
  • Provide support that can result in parents feeling more bonded with their newborns.
  • Provide support that can result in a baby breastfeeding longer and more exclusively.

Doulas with Welcome Home Midwifery Services...

  • Offer doula services billed on an income-based sliding scale, with volunteer services available for qualifying families.
  • Complete a minimum training requirement including classroom learning and hands-on training prior to attending births that exceeds most doula trainings, and emphasizes providing culturally humble and accessible doula care to families in Sacramento and San Joaquin counties.
  • Provide evidence-based support with standardized organization-wide practice guidelines, experienced mentorship and oversight, and quality improvement measures ensuring excellent care.
  • Are experienced and comfortable with births in all hospitals in the greater Sacramento region, most medical practices, and several home birth midwives.
  • Work in pairs, allowing your family to have the support of 2 trained doulas at each birth, and minimizing the risk of having a backup doula you do not know attending your birth.
  • Participate in monthly confidential peer reviews with a network of several disciplines including midwifery, lactation, and social work, providing clients with the best possible resources for their doula care.
  • Offer full continuity of care to all clients, including online and phone support, 2 prenatal home visits, on-call services for labor and birth, and 2 postpartum home visits.
  • Believe that doula care during childbirth is a basic human right, and work to emphasize improving access to doula care for low-income families.
